summ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orGilles Dartiguelongue <eva@gentoo.org>2007-10-17 20:26:00 +0000
committerGilles Dartiguelongue <eva@gentoo.org>2007-10-17 20:26:00 +0000
commit5dac5d6936240b67e7033a7f5197f366e56ffab9 (patch)
treeeb4ab43e5b2f14514cad8c8880453d6930d3695f /gnome-base/gnome-menus
parentRemove dysfunctional linguas_ja USE flag. (diff)
downloadgentoo-2-5dac5d6936240b67e7033a7f5197f366e56ffab9.tar.gz
gentoo-2-5dac5d6936240b67e7033a7f5197f366e56ffab9.tar.bz2
gentoo-2-5dac5d6936240b67e7033a7f5197f366e56ffab9.zip
bump to 2.20.1
(Portage version: 2.1.3.13)
Diffstat (limited to 'gnome-base/gnome-menus')
-rw-r--r--gnome-base/gnome-menus/ChangeLog12
-rw-r--r--gnome-base/gnome-menus/files/digest-gnome-menus-2.20.13
-rw-r--r--gnome-base/gnome-menus/gnome-menus-2.16.1.ebuild4
-rw-r--r--gnome-base/gnome-menus/gnome-menus-2.20.0.ebuild4
-rw-r--r--gnome-base/gnome-menus/gnome-menus-2.20.1.ebuild50
5 files changed, 68 insertions, 5 deletions
diff --git a/gnome-base/gnome-menus/ChangeLog b/gnome-base/gnome-menus/ChangeLog
index 28a78b67bb79..aa3b401a524d 100644
--- a/gnome-base/gnome-menus/ChangeLog
+++ b/gnome-base/gnome-menus/ChangeLog
@@ -1,6 +1,16 @@
# ChangeLog for gnome-base/gnome-menus
# Copyright 1999-2007 Gentoo Foundation; Distributed under the GPL v2
-# $Header: /var/cvsroot/gentoo-x86/gnome-base/gnome-menus/ChangeLog,v 1.88 2007/10/01 09:53:20 leio Exp $
+# $Header: /var/cvsroot/gentoo-x86/gnome-base/gnome-menus/ChangeLog,v 1.89 2007/10/17 20:25:59 eva Exp $
+
+ 17 Oct 2007; Gilles Dartiguelongue <eva@gentoo.org>
+ gnome-menus-2.16.1.ebuild:
+ fix minor QA
+
+*gnome-menus-2.20.1 (17 Oct 2007)
+
+ 17 Oct 2007; Gilles Dartiguelongue <eva@gentoo.org>
+ gnome-menus-2.20.0.ebuild, +gnome-menus-2.20.1.ebuild:
+ bump to 2.20.1 and fix inherit
*gnome-menus-2.20.0 (01 Oct 2007)
diff --git a/gnome-base/gnome-menus/files/digest-gnome-menus-2.20.1 b/gnome-base/gnome-menus/files/digest-gnome-menus-2.20.1
new file mode 100644
index 000000000000..12de56891c42
--- /dev/null
+++ b/gnome-base/gnome-menus/files/digest-gnome-menus-2.20.1
@@ -0,0 +1,3 @@
+MD5 ad141dc4d5e485e613b68f9fa58bae5f gnome-menus-2.20.1.tar.bz2 450569
+RMD160 8ffef9d7e76c9876df720436feb99ab36404ee9d gnome-menus-2.20.1.tar.bz2 450569
+SHA256 f6c147983b8c2a6ed0798667d9bd2f58a47b6e6b8e4ab850f83db82beda6badb gnome-menus-2.20.1.tar.bz2 450569
diff --git a/gnome-base/gnome-menus/gnome-menus-2.16.1.ebuild b/gnome-base/gnome-menus/gnome-menus-2.16.1.ebuild
index 261b664ed031..c2a1461d1dc7 100644
--- a/gnome-base/gnome-menus/gnome-menus-2.16.1.ebuild
+++ b/gnome-base/gnome-menus/gnome-menus-2.16.1.ebuild
@@ -1,6 +1,6 @@
# Copyright 1999-2007 Gentoo Foundation
# Distributed under the terms of the GNU General Public License v2
-# $Header: /var/cvsroot/gentoo-x86/gnome-base/gnome-menus/gnome-menus-2.16.1.ebuild,v 1.13 2007/06/17 15:25:00 dang Exp $
+# $Header: /var/cvsroot/gentoo-x86/gnome-base/gnome-menus/gnome-menus-2.16.1.ebuild,v 1.14 2007/10/17 20:25:59 eva Exp $
inherit eutils gnome2 python multilib
@@ -32,7 +32,7 @@ src_unpack() {
pkg_postinst() {
gnome2_pkg_postinst
- python_mod_optimize ${ROOT}usr/$(get_libdir)/python*/site-packages
+ python_mod_optimize "${ROOT}"usr/$(get_libdir)/python*/site-packages
}
pkg_postrm() {
diff --git a/gnome-base/gnome-menus/gnome-menus-2.20.0.ebuild b/gnome-base/gnome-menus/gnome-menus-2.20.0.ebuild
index 0456926df240..0bcbe3caafab 100644
--- a/gnome-base/gnome-menus/gnome-menus-2.20.0.ebuild
+++ b/gnome-base/gnome-menus/gnome-menus-2.20.0.ebuild
@@ -1,8 +1,8 @@
# Copyright 1999-2007 Gentoo Foundation
# Distributed under the terms of the GNU General Public License v2
-# $Header: /var/cvsroot/gentoo-x86/gnome-base/gnome-menus/gnome-menus-2.20.0.ebuild,v 1.1 2007/10/01 09:53:20 leio Exp $
+# $Header: /var/cvsroot/gentoo-x86/gnome-base/gnome-menus/gnome-menus-2.20.0.ebuild,v 1.2 2007/10/17 20:25:59 eva Exp $
-inherit eutils gnome2 python multilib
+inherit eutils gnome2 python multilib linux-info
DESCRIPTION="The GNOME menu system, implementing the F.D.O cross-desktop spec"
HOMEPAGE="http://www.gnome.org"
diff --git a/gnome-base/gnome-menus/gnome-menus-2.20.1.ebuild b/gnome-base/gnome-menus/gnome-menus-2.20.1.ebuild
new file mode 100644
index 000000000000..08d236d52d3a
--- /dev/null
+++ b/gnome-base/gnome-menus/gnome-menus-2.20.1.ebuild
@@ -0,0 +1,50 @@
+# Copyright 1999-2007 Gentoo Foundation
+# Distributed under the terms of the GNU General Public License v2
+# $Header: /var/cvsroot/gentoo-x86/gnome-base/gnome-menus/gnome-menus-2.20.1.ebuild,v 1.1 2007/10/17 20:25:59 eva Exp $
+
+inherit eutils gnome2 python multilib linux-info
+
+DESCRIPTION="The GNOME menu system, implementing the F.D.O cross-desktop spec"
+HOMEPAGE="http://www.gnome.org"
+
+LICENSE="GPL-2 LGPL-2"
+SLOT="0"
+KEYWORDS="~alpha ~amd64 ~arm ~hppa ~ia64 ~ppc ~ppc64 ~sh ~sparc ~x86 ~x86-fbsd"
+IUSE="debug python kernel_linux"
+
+RDEPEND=">=dev-libs/glib-2.6
+ python? (
+ >=dev-lang/python-2.4.4-r5
+ dev-python/pygtk
+ )"
+DEPEND="${RDEPEND}
+ sys-devel/gettext
+ >=dev-util/pkgconfig-0.9
+ >=dev-util/intltool-0.35"
+
+DOCS="AUTHORS ChangeLog HACKING NEWS README"
+
+pkg_setup() {
+ if use kernel_linux ; then
+ CONFIG_CHECK="~INOTIFY"
+ linux-info_pkg_setup
+ fi
+
+ G2CONF="$(use_enable kernel_linux inotify) $(use_enable debug) $(use_enable python)"
+}
+
+src_unpack() {
+ gnome2_src_unpack
+ # Don't show KDE standalone settings desktop files in GNOME others menu
+ epatch "${FILESDIR}/${PN}-2.18.3-ignore_kde_standalone.patch"
+}
+
+pkg_postinst() {
+ gnome2_pkg_postinst
+ use python && python_mod_optimize "${ROOT}"usr/$(get_libdir)/python*/site-packages
+}
+
+pkg_postrm() {
+ gnome2_pkg_postrm
+ use python && python_mod_cleanup "${ROOT}"usr/$(get_libdir)/python*/site-packages
+}